Mastering the Art of Sheepdog Training for Efficient Livestock Management

Understanding the Role of Sheepdogs
Sheepdogs play a vital role in modern livestock farming, acting as intelligent partners that assist handlers in managing sheep with precision and care. These dogs are bred for their instinct, agility, and responsiveness, making them invaluable in herding tasks across farms and open pastures. Sheepdog training focuses on channeling these natural instincts into controlled actions, ensuring that the dog can respond to commands while maintaining calm and organized livestock movement. A well-trained sheepdog reduces the need for manual labor and enhances overall farm productivity.

Building a Strong Foundation Through Early Training
Effective sheepdog training begins at an early age, where young dogs are gradually introduced to basic obedience and socialization. This foundational stage ensures the dog develops discipline, trust, and familiarity with its handler. Commands such as “come,” “stay,” and directional cues form the backbone of advanced training. Early exposure to livestock in a controlled environment helps the dog understand boundaries and proper herding behavior without overwhelming it. Consistency, patience, and positive reinforcement are key elements in shaping a reliable working dog.

Advanced Herding Techniques and Commands
As the sheepdog progresses, training becomes more specialized, incorporating advanced herding techniques and precise commands. Dogs learn directional cues like “come by” (clockwise) and “away” (counterclockwise), along with commands to stop, lie down, or gather livestock. These skills allow handlers to control the movement of sheep over large distances and challenging terrains. Advanced training also focuses on problem-solving, enabling the dog to adapt to unpredictable livestock behavior. This level of expertise is essential for efficient livestock handling services in both small farms and large-scale operations.

Enhancing Communication Between Handler and Dog
A successful sheepdog team relies on clear communication and mutual understanding between the handler and the dog. Training emphasizes voice commands, whistle signals, and body language to ensure seamless coordination. Handlers must learn to read their dog’s movements and anticipate livestock reactions, creating a synchronized workflow. Regular practice strengthens this bond, allowing the dog to respond quickly and confidently in real-life scenarios. Strong communication not only improves efficiency but also ensures the safety of both the livestock and the working dog.
